Valentine’s Day Staycations

You don’t need to go far to get amorous with the one you love—local hotels are offering plenty of romance-filled specials.

A stay at the Hotel Monaco gives you the perfect recipe for a romantic night—a bath for two and animal-print robes. Rawr. Photograph courtesy of Hotel Monaco.

Even when it doesn’t fall on a Monday, there’s never quite enough time to steal away on Valentine’s Day. Fortunately, many area hotels are offering couples “staycations” designed to squeeze every ounce of romance out of a weekend. We’ve compiled a few options below that will leave your sweetheart pleased, smitten, or head over heels, depending on your budget. Prices reflect a one-night stay.

The Big Night Package at the Inn at Little Washington
The Inn at Little Washington is not only one of the most plush and expensive boutique hotels in the area, but also boasts a restaurant that ranks second on our 100 Very Best Restaurants list this year. This package lets you and your honey experience both luxuries: overnight accommodations, a welcome cocktail, afternoon tea, a signed copy of 85 Inspirational Chefs, the new Relais and Chateaux cookbook, and breakfast in the morning. The pièce de résistance however, is the nine-course tasting menu served at the Chef's table in the kitchen, along with wine pairings from the sommelier. The Valentine's Day menu includes miniature filets of black cod sauté with shrimp dumplings, and macaroni-and-cheese with Virginia country ham and shaved white truffle.
